Transaction 96beefc18bde6e9829e85dca3e682f17fa886028cf56b03fc22a788dc56f3713

1 Input
1 Outputs
  • 96beefc18bde6e9829e85dca3e682f17fa886028cf56b03fc22a788dc56f3713:0
  • value  2051924
    address  1CP8JxgRKxHPxHUqHvDwDfTbkZLpZfiwmV